As of March 31, 2024, the following were the top institutional holders of Centrus Energy Corp. (LEU):

  • Renaissance Technologies LLC: Holding 1,022,136 shares
  • The Vanguard Group, Inc.: Holding 924,873 shares
  • BlackRock Fund Advisors: Holding 597,427 shares
  • Van Eck Associates Corp: Holding 527,234 shares
  • Geode Capital Management, LLC: Holding 311,482 shares

These institutions collectively hold a significant percentage of Centrus Energy Corp. (LEU)'s outstanding shares, making their investment decisions particularly influential. Data is sourced from the most recent quarterly filings, providing an up-to-date snapshot of institutional positions.

Tracking changes in institutional ownership provides insights into the evolving sentiment surrounding Centrus Energy Corp. (LEU). Recent transactions by major institutional investors include:

Recent Changes in Ownership (Q1 2024):

  • Renaissance Technologies LLC: Increased its holdings by 37,836 shares.
  • The Vanguard Group, Inc.: Increased its holdings by 47,750 shares.
  • Van Eck Associates Corp: Increased its holdings by 34,542 shares.

These changes suggest a bullish outlook from some major institutional investors, potentially driven by positive company performance, industry trends, or broader market conditions.

Information on investor holdings and recent transactions can often be found in regulatory filings, such as Form 4s (insider trading), 13D/G filings (ownership of 5% or more), and institutional holdings reports (13F filings).

Analyzing these filings can reveal trends in investor sentiment and potential catalysts for stock movement.

Institutional investors play a significant role in Centrus Energy Corp. Here's a look at some of the top institutional holders:

Rank Holder Shares Held % Outstanding Value ($)
1 BlackRock Fund Advisors 1,314,521 8.64% 78.87 million
2 Vanguard Fiduciary Trust Co. 1,079,716 7.10% 64.79 million
3 Dimensional Fund Advisors LP 894,142 5.88% 53.67 million
4 Geode Capital Management LLC 321,437 2.11% 19.28 million
5 Northern Trust Investments, Inc. 255,798 1.68% 15.35 million
